The following diagram shows an output with a suppression device. We recommend
that you locate the suppression device as close as possible to the load device.
If you connect an SLC 500 controller dc output to an inductive load, we
recommend that you use a 1N4004 diode for surge suppression, as shown in the
illustration that follows.
Suitable surge suppression methods for inductive ac load devices include a varistor,
an RC network, or an Allen-Bradley surge suppressor, all shown below. These
components must be appropriately rated to suppress the switching transient
characteristic of the particular inductive device.
